JOB SEARCH / Supply Chain Coordinator
Job Responsibilities
- Provide Materials Management (MM) advices to distributors and hospitals to ensure safety-stocks and documents expectations are in line with updates and corporate policies.
- Inform customers of any delays in picking up containers from the Port to avoid detention/ demurrage (payment of additional charges).
- Handle all incoming customers and distributors’ related claims and complaints (short shipments, damaged goods, expired goods, undertaking letters, wrong prices & any other customer related complaints). Create a file for each new complaint in order to have proper backup documentation and traceability which will help the Finance department.
- Ensure orders are entered promptly and accurately the soonest.
- Follow up to issue Debit/Credit for approved discrepancies and update the Debit/Credit database accordingly for any claim related issues.
- Provide complete and fast customers service on all MM related issues to internal and external customers.
- Ensure and manage filing of MM-related documentation.
- Create monthly check of open-orders to prevent incorrect delivery conditions and commissions from being invoiced.
- Prepare reports showing no discrepancies and/or rectifications on monthly basis.
Qualifications
- Minimum 2 years of experience in Logistics and Demand fields
- Bachelor Degree in Commerce/Sciences, Finance or equivalent
- Fluency in English
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office Excel and Word
- AS400/Manugistics experience is desirable
